Job Directory Sr. Data Engineer

Sr. Data Engineer
Seattle, WA

Companies like
are looking for tech talent like you.

On Hired, employers apply to you with up-front salaries.
Sign up to start matching for free.

About

Job Description

Overview

Beyondsoft Consulting, Inc., is a leading, technical solutions and consulting partner. We combine emerging technologies and proven methodologies to tailor elegant solutions that solve complex challenges and empower our customers to accelerate their business goals. Our services include end-to-end support for cloud, digital, data analytics, multi-language translation, and testing.

Our client is growing their Data Engineering team within a demanding and well recognized enterprise and information technology company. This role will be the core solution of the Strategic Analytics organization, ensuring both the reliability and applicability of the team's data products to the organization. This individual will have extensive experience with ETL design, coding, and testing patterns as well as engineering software platforms and large-scale data infrastructures. The Data Engineers will have the capability to architect highly scalable end-to-end pipeline using different open source tools, including building and operationalizing high-performance algorithms. Proven experience with technologies to solve big data problems with expert knowledge in programming languages like Java, Python, Linux, PHP, Hive, Impala, and Spark.

Responsibilities

Responsibilities:

* Translate complex functional and technical requirements into detailed design
* Hadoop technical development and implementation
* Loading from disparate data sets by leveraging various big data technology e.g. Kafka
* Pre-processing using Hive, Impala, Spark, and Pig
* Design and implement data modeling
* Maintain security and data privacy in an environment secured using Kerberos and LDAP
* High-speed querying using in-memory technologies such as Spark
* Following and contributing best engineering practice for source control, release management, deployment etc
* Production support, job scheduling/monitoring, ETL data quality, data freshness reporting

Qualifications

Qualifications:

* 5-8 years of Python or Java/J2EE development experience
* 3+ years of demonstrated technical proficiency with Hadoop and big data projects
* 5-8 years of demonstrated experience and success in data modeling
* Fluent in writing shell scripts [bash, korn]
* Writing high-performance, reliable and maintainable code
* Ability to write MapReduce jobs
* Knowledge of database structures, theories, principles, and practices
* Understand how to develop code in an environment secured using a local KDC and OpenLDAP
* Familiarity with and implementation knowledge of loading data using Sqoop
* Knowledge and ability to implement workflow/schedulers within Oozie
* Experience working with AWS components [EC2, S3, SNS, SQS]
* Analytical and problem-solving skills, applied to Big Data domain
* Proven understanding and hands on experience with Hadoop, Hive, Pig, Impala, and Spark
* Aptitude in multi-threading and concurrency concepts
* M.S. in Computer Science or Engineering

We are an equal opportunity employer and value diversity at our company. We do not discriminate based on race, religion, color, national origin, gender, sexual orientation, age, marital status, veteran status, or disability

Let your dream job find you.

Sign up to start matching with top companies. It’s fast and free.